Due to long waiting lists, private adhd assessment reading clinics can often offer faster assessments than the NHS. This poses a problem for the NHS and patients, who may receive incorrect diagnoses from private clinics that don't adhere to the national guidelines. The BBC has spoken to hundreds of patients who claim to have been misdiagnosed with ADHD by Private adhd assessment worcestershire (sethpkape.blogpayz.com) clinics like Harley Psychiatrists or ADHD 360. They were offered powerful drugs without proper tests.

A valid diagnosis of ADHD requires a detailed evaluation by a psychiatrist or a specialist nurse. They must be UK registered and have had experience in assessing for ADHD according to Nice guidelines. They should also be trained in interpreting results from clinical interviews and rating scales. They must also review education records and interview teachers, if necessary.
